Netflix Series 'Florida Man' Debuts With Zero Critics Score On Rotten Tomatoes
BY SACNILK
Los Angeles, April 17 - Netflix series Florida Man debuts with the lowest rating possible on the reviews aggregation website Rotten Tomatoes after just 5 critics reviews. ## "Florida Man" which premiered on April 13, has become one of the rarest web series to score ZERO ratings from critics on Rotten Tomatoes. However, it does not seem that series is that bad as the audience score is on the higher side with 85% from over 100 users at the time of writing this piece. ## On the other side, the nothing reviews from critics aren't affecting the viewership at all as the series is the second most watched English title currently in Netflix's weekly top 10 list, behind only "Beef" this weekend.## The series stars Edgar Ramirez as a struggling ex-cop forced to return to his home state of Florida to find a Philly mobster's runaway girlfriend. What should be a quick gig becomes a spiraling journey into buried family secrets and an increasingly futile attempt to do the right thing. ## Created by Donald Todd, the series has 7 episodes and all are streaming simultaneously. In India, it is streaming English and Hindi languages with English subtitles. It also stars Anthony LaPaglia, Abbey Lee, Otmara Marrero, Lex Scott Davis, Emory Cohen, and Isaiah Johnson also star in the main roles. ## Stay tuned...
